Second in three stages of the EpiqE Series Circuit Trot, Bold Eagle <\/strong> will be in action on January 28th to try to win a third consecutive Grand Prix d’Am\u00e9rique. He is one of three trotters qualified by S\u00e9bastien Guarato (at the top of the EpiqE rankings of coaches) with Valko Jenilat <\/strong> and Billie de Montfort <\/strong>, first and second of the Grand Prix of Britain. Philippe Allaire will be able to count on Bird Parker, double stage winner in the Grand Prix du Bourbonnais and Belgium, and Charly du Noyer <\/strong>. Thierry Duvaldestin qualifies meanwhile for the second year in a row Briac Dark <\/strong>, third of the Grand Prix de Bourgogne. Laureate Crit\u00e9rium Continental, Doria Desbois <\/strong> has been injured since and Christophe Feyte’s prot\u00e9g\u00e9 will not be on the starting grid on the last Sunday of January.<\/p>\n Three foreign competitors under the wing of Daniel Red\u00e9n, Timo Nurmos and Jerry Riordan also validated their ticket for America: Propulsion <\/strong>, Readly Express <\/strong> and Ringostarr Treb <\/strong>. Winner of the Prix T\u00e9nor de Baune and third of the recent Grand Prix de Belgique, Readly Express <\/strong> announces himself as one of the contenders for the title with Propulsion<\/strong>, winner of the Grand Prix de Bourgogne.
